## Catalog Cache Invalidation — Ondri Commerce

The product catalog caches render fragments in Hearthcache with a 10-minute TTL. Price or inventory changes emit an invalidation event on the `catalog.purge` topic; consumers must acknowledge within 5 seconds or the purge is retried. Never invalidate by wildcard in production — enumerate SKUs explicitly. Purge requests are authenticated, and each batch must be signed with the catalog deploy key shown below.

signing key of bagap-yawep = bky13_TbfT6ZMUoGJo2

### Key Ceremony Checklist — Item 7: DocSentry Linter Signing Key

Before proceeding, confirm that the DocSentry linter's rule-bundle signing key has been generated on the air-gapped workstation and that both witnesses (your ceremony lead and the compliance observer) have initialed the log sheet. Do not skip the witness step, even if the lead says it's fine. Once the key material is sealed in the envelope, record the recovery passphrase that unlocks the backup shard exactly as spoken by the ceremony lead.

strongbox words: gilok-druion-briath-wendor-briion-prawyn-fenion-oliir-casdor-holius-briius-gilath-gilael-pelys

Subject: Handover — Pingfold dedup release

Welcome aboard. Pingfold deduplicates on-call alerts before they hit pagers. Releases go out Tuesdays. Run the smoke suite, check the suppression-rate dashboard, then tag and push. Rollback is one command; notes in the wiki. Production artifacts must be signed. The current release signing key is as follows.

rollout seal: bky4_x7Gc